网络路径切换方法和装置制造方法及图纸

技术编号:14532803 阅读:56 留言:0更新日期:2017-02-02 15:39
本发明专利技术公开了一种网络路径切换方法,在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息;所述在线单板获取所述槽位信息对应的双向转发检测信息;根据预设的双向转发检测信息与网络路径标识的映射关系,所述在线单板获取确定的双向转发检测信息对应的网络路径标识;所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中。本发明专利技术还公开了一种网络路径切换装置。本发明专利技术提高了网络路径的切换速度。

Network path switching method and device

The invention discloses a method for switching network path, receiving information sent by the main control offline, online board based on the off-line information to obtain the corresponding slot information; the online single board gets bidirectional forwarding detection information of the corresponding slot information; according to the bidirectional forwarding detection mapping information and network the default path identification, bidirectional forwarding detection information corresponding to the network path identifying the online single board gets to determine the path of the online network; the single board to the offline single board current network path switching to the network path identification in the corresponding. The invention also discloses a network path switching device. The invention improves the switching speed of the network path.

【技术实现步骤摘要】

本专利技术涉及网络通信领域,尤其涉及一种网络路径切换方法和装置。
技术介绍
随着网络通信技术的发展,目前典型的L2VPN网络(二层虚拟专用网)或者L3VPN网络(三层虚拟专用网)中,通常会部署多层次的保护路径,比如PW层(PseudoWire,边缘路由器对之间的点对点的连接)保护路径、隧道层保护路径、链路层保护路径等,以供网络路径出现故障时,可以将网络路径切换到部署的保护路径中。通常情况下,会部署BFD(双向转发检测)协议来快速检测网络路径的连通性,而现有的检测方式都是将BFD部署于单板上,通过在线单板发送的BFD报文实现定时检测网络路径的连通性,并在检测网络路径出现异常时,快速切换到保护路径中,而当单板处于离线状态时,离线单板无法切换网络路径,只能通过主控将离线单板的网络路径切换至在线单板,而主控属于上层控制面,网络路径处于底层转发面,主控控制网络路径切换的速度慢,如无法满足电信级50ms的切换性能。
技术实现思路
本专利技术的主要目的在于提出一种网络路径切换方法和装置,旨在解决单板处于离线状态时,网络路径的切换速度慢的技术问题。为实现上述目的,本专利技术提供的一种网络路径切换方法,所述网络路径切换方法包括以下步骤:在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息;所述在线单板获取所述槽位信息对应的双向转发检测信息;根据预设的双向转发检测信息与网络路径标识的映射关系,所述在线单板获取确定的双向转发检测信息对应的网络路径标识;所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中。优选地,当获取的所述网络路径标识包括多个时,所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中的步骤包括:所述在线单板确定各个网络路径标识对应的网络路径的优先级;所述在线单板将所述离线单板当前网络路径切换到优先级高的网络路径中。优选地,所述在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息的步骤之前,所述网络路径切换方法包括:所述终端在初始化时,触发离线信息接收指令以进入离线信息接收模式;或者在接收到用户输入的离线信息接收指令时,所述终端进入离线信息接收模式。优选地,所述在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息的步骤之前,所述网络路径切换方法包括:所述在线单板接收所述主控发送的其所在的路由设备中所有单板的双向转发检测信息;所述在线单板存储接收到的所述双向转发检测信息。优选地,所述双向转发检测信息由所述主控在所述双向转发检测信息更新时发送至所述在线单板。此外,为实现上述目的,本专利技术还提出一种网络路径切换装置,所述网络路径切换装置包括:获取模块,用于在接收到主控发送的离线信息时,基于所述离线信息获取对应的槽位信息;所述获取模块,还用于获取所述槽位信息对应的双向转发检测信息;所述获取模块,还用于根据预设的双向转发检测信息与网络路径标识的映射关系,获取确定的双向转发检测信息对应的网络路径标识;切换模块,用于将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中。优选地,当获取的所述网络路径标识包括多个时,所述切换模块包括:确定单元,用于确定各个网络路径标识对应的网络路径的优先级;切换单元,用于将所述离线单板当前网络路径切换到优先级高的网络路径中。优选地,所述网络路径切换装置还包括:预处理模块,用于在初始化时,触发离线信息接收指令以进入离线信息接收模式;或者在接收到用户输入的离线信息接收指令时,进入离线信息接收模式。优选地,所述网络路径切换装置还包括:接收模块,用于接收所述主控发送的其所在的路由设备中所有单板的双向转发检测信息;存储模块,用于存储接收到的所述双向转发检测信息。优选地,所述双向转发检测信息由所述主控在所述双向转发检测信息更新时发送至所述接收模块。本专利技术提出的网络路径切换方法和装置,在线单板先根据获取的槽位信息,获取所述槽位信息对应的双向转发检测信息,然后根据所述双向转发检测信息获取对应的网络路径标识,并直接将所述离线单板的当前网络路径切换到获取的所述网络路径标识对应的网络路径中,实现了单板离线时,其它在线单板可以先获取离线单板的槽位信息,并根据具体的处理操作将离线单板当前的网络路径切换到获取的网络路径标识对应的网络路径中,而不是在单板离线时,只能通过主控将离线单板的网络路径切换至在线单板,从而提高了网络路径的切换速度。附图说明图1为本专利技术网络路径切换方法第一实施例的流程示意图;图2为本专利技术网络路径切换方法第二实施例的流程示意图;图3为本专利技术网络路径切换方法第三实施例的流程示意图;图4为本专利技术网络路径切换方法第四实施例的流程示意图;图5为本专利技术网络路径切换装置第一实施例的功能模块示意图;图6为本专利技术网络路径切换装置第二实施例的功能模块示意图;图7为本专利技术网络路径切换装置第三实施例的功能模块示意图。图8为本专利技术网络路径切换装置第四实施例的功能模块示意图。本专利技术目的的实现、功能特点及优点将结合实施例,参照附图做进一步说明。具体实施方式应当理解,此处所描述的具体实施例仅仅用以解释本专利技术,并不用于限定本专利技术。本专利技术提供一种网络路径切换方法。参照图1,图1为本专利技术网络路径切换方法第一实施例的流程示意图。本实施例提出一种网络路径切换方法,所述网络路径切换方法包括:步骤S10,在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息;在本实施例中,所述在线单板接收到主控发送的离线信息的方式包括所述在线单板接收主控广播的离线信息,然后基于所述离线信息获取对应的槽位信息,或者所述在线单板接收主控发送给所述在线单板预设位置(如在线单板的预设接收点)的离线信息,然后基于所述离线信息获取对应的槽位信息。可以理解的是,可事先预设主控实时检测各个单板的运行状态,当所述主控检测到单板不在位时,即可判定所述单板离线,然后获取离线单板的槽位信息,并进一步获取所述离线线卡的其它标识信息,将获取的所述槽位信息以及所述其它标识信息一起作为离线信息通过广播等方式发送到其它各个在线单板,以供所述在线单板接收主控发送的离线信息时,提取对应的槽位信息。本专利技术实施例中,所述在线线卡仅接收同一个路由设备中主控发送的离线信息。所述离线信息优选包括离线单板对应的槽位信息以及所述离线线卡的标识信息,双向转发检测标识符等。步骤S20,所述在线单板获取所述槽位信息对应的双向转发检测信息;在本实施例中,每一个单板都会存储同一台路由设备中的所有单板的双向转发检测信息,根据上述实施例可知,双向转发检测信息包含各个单板对应的槽位信息以及双向转发检测标识符,由于所述槽位信息以及双向转发检测信息中都包含单板的槽位号,则所述在线单板在获取到所述槽位信息时,即可根据预设的双向转发检测信息查询与所述槽位信息的槽位号匹配的双向转发检测信息,以获取对应的双向转发检测信息,所述查询方式优选所述在线单板遍历预设的各个双向转发检测信息,即所述在线单板将所述槽位信息与预设的双向转发检测信息进行比对,在检测槽位号与所述接收到的槽位信息的槽位号匹配的双向转发检测信息时,确定匹配的双向转发检测信息并获取所述匹配的双向转发检测信息。在本实施本文档来自技高网...

【技术保护点】
一种网络路径切换方法,其特征在于,所述网络路径切换方法包括以下步骤:在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息;所述在线单板获取所述槽位信息对应的双向转发检测信息;根据预设的双向转发检测信息与网络路径标识的映射关系,所述在线单板获取确定的双向转发检测信息对应的网络路径标识;所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中。

【技术特征摘要】
1.一种网络路径切换方法,其特征在于,所述网络路径切换方法包括以下步骤:在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息;所述在线单板获取所述槽位信息对应的双向转发检测信息;根据预设的双向转发检测信息与网络路径标识的映射关系,所述在线单板获取确定的双向转发检测信息对应的网络路径标识;所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中。2.如权利要求1所述的网络路径切换方法,其特征在于,当获取的所述网络路径标识包括多个时,所述在线单板将所述离线单板当前网络路径切换到所述网络路径标识对应的网络路径中的步骤包括:所述在线单板确定各个网络路径标识对应的网络路径的优先级;所述在线单板将所述离线单板当前网络路径切换到优先级高的网络路径中。3.如权利要求1或2所述的网络路径切换方法,其特征在于,所述在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息的步骤之前,所述网络路径切换方法包括:所述终端在初始化时,触发离线信息接收指令以进入离线信息接收模式;或者在接收到用户输入的离线信息接收指令时,所述终端进入离线信息接收模式。4.如权利要求1或2所述的网络路径切换方法,其特征在于,所述在接收到主控发送的离线信息时,在线单板基于所述离线信息获取对应的槽位信息的步骤之前,所述网络路径切换方法包括:所述在线单板接收所述主控发送的其所在的路由设备中所有单板的双向
\t转发检测信息;所述在线单板存储接收到的所述双向转发检测信息。5.如权利要求4所述的...

【专利技术属性】
技术研发人员:李爱民
申请(专利权)人:中兴通讯股份有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1